Clamping device for clamping a hollow workpiece and method for machining, measuring and / or testing a hollow workpiece
The clamping device with a radially expandable and rotatable sleeve and mandrel design addresses the challenge of clamping hollow workpieces, ensuring precise processing and measurement by minimizing runout and enhancing process efficiency.

Existing clamping devices struggle to effectively clamp and process hollow workpieces, particularly those with high accuracy requirements, such as micro gears and hollow shafts, while minimizing runout and ensuring precise machining, measuring, and testing.
A clamping device featuring a clamping sleeve and mandrel with radially expandable and rotatable components, utilizing complementary round wedge sections for self-locking and easy release, allowing for precise clamping and processing of hollow workpieces, including micro gears and hollow shafts.
Enhances process safety, reduces runout, and enables efficient in-line processing, measuring, and testing of hollow workpieces with improved accuracy and reduced time.

[0001] The invention relates to a clamping device for clamping a hollow workpiece with an inner workpiece surface. The clamping device comprises a clamping axis, a radially expandable clamping sleeve with an outer clamping sleeve surface associated with the inner workpiece surface and a clamping sleeve inner surface, and a clamping mandrel with an outer clamping mandrel surface associated with the inner clamping sleeve surface for radially expanding the clamping sleeve. Furthermore, the invention relates to a method for machining, measuring, and / or testing a hollow workpiece with an inner workpiece surface.
[0002] Document DE 24 05 527 A1 relates to a feed collet with a clamping sleeve that is longitudinally slotted to form clamping jaws for engaging the bar material, and a receiving bushing into which the clamping sleeve can be inserted and screwed adjustably by means of a thread. The clamping sleeve has an outer cone tapering in the insertion direction on its circumference, and the receiving bushing has a corresponding inner cone, which cooperate to adjust the radial clamping force of the clamping sleeve. In order to enable adjustment of the feed force and to reduce cylindrical clamping and wear of the inner bore when adjusting the clamping force, document DE 24 05 527 A1 proposes designing the receiving bushing as an outer clamping sleeve with multiple longitudinal slots, which generates the radial clamping force and transmits it radially to the clamping sleeve.
[0003] Document DE 199 31 861 A1 relates to a clamping device comprising a mandrel provided at least at one end with coupling elements for coupling to the main spindle of a machine tool. In order to ensure that very thin-walled and relatively long workpieces can be properly clamped largely independent of irregularities in their outer surface, and that their inner surface can be machined with the required accuracy and surface quality, document DE 199 31 861 A1 proposes that the mandrel have a first contact surface at one end region, which is axially aligned and faces the other end region of the mandrel, which is arranged immovably on the mandrel in the axial direction. A second contact surface is provided on the mandrel at the other end region, which is axially aligned and faces one end region and is arranged on a clamping body that is guided displaceably on the mandrel in the axial direction.a clamping device is provided by means of which the clamping body with the second contact surface can be adjusted relative to the first contact surface and can be fixed to the clamping mandrel by applying an axial clamping force, at least one clamping sleeve is provided which is made of an elastomer, the inner diameter of which is matched to the outer diameter of the clamping mandrel, the end faces of which are matched to the first contact surface and the second contact surface, the clamping sleeve has on its outer side a plurality of support strips made of a metallic material which are permanently connected to the clamping sleeve, which are evenly distributed around the circumference of the clamping sleeve and whose outer side each forms a cylindrical surface section which is matched to the inner diameter of the workpiece.

[0027] The method is designed to machine, measure, and / or inspect a hollow workpiece with an inner surface. The method can be designed to machine, measure, and / or inspect a toothing or gear, in particular using a rolling test, in particular using a single-flank rolling test. For this purpose, the workpiece is clamped using such a clamping device.
[0028] The invention improves the machining, measuring, and / or testing of a hollow workpiece, both in process and in result. Process reliability is increased. Efforts, such as time, are reduced. A fixture-related runout error is reduced. In-line machining, measuring, and / or testing is enabled.

[0030] Fig. 1 shows a clamping device 100 and a workpiece 102 arranged on the clamping device 100. The workpiece 102 has a hollow shaft section 104 with a circular-cylindrical workpiece inner surface and a gear section 106 forming a microgear. The clamping device 100 has a clamping axis 108, a clamping sleeve 110, and a clamping mandrel 112. The clamping sleeve 110 is pushed axially onto the clamping mandrel 112.
[0031] The clamping device 100 is adjustable between a release position and a clamping position by rotating the clamping sleeve 110. In the release position, the workpiece 102 can be pushed axially onto the clamping device 100 with its inner surface or removed from the clamping device 100. Fig. 1 shows the clamping device 100 with a workpiece 102 pushed onto it. In the clamped position, the workpiece 102 is frictionally connected to the clamping device 100. The clamping device 100 is designed such that the frictional connection between the clamping device 100 and the workpiece 102 enables machining, measuring, or testing of the workpiece 102.
[0032] Fig. 2 shows an arrangement 200 for rolling testing a micro gear of a workpiece 204 formed by means of a gear section 202, such as workpiece 102 with gear section 106 according to Fig. 1. For this purpose, the workpiece 204 is clamped to a clamping device 206, such as clamping device 100 according to Fig. 1, clamped. A workpiece 208 with a gear section 210 forming a master gear is clamped with a corresponding clamping device 212. The clamping device 206 with the workpiece 204 and the clamping device 212 with the workpiece 208 are arranged with mutually parallel clamping axes 214, 216 and intermeshing gear sections 202, 210 in a measuring device (not shown in detail here).

[0039] The clamping sleeve 300 has four first round wedge sections, such as 336. The first round wedge sections 336 are arranged on the clamping sleeve inner surface 306 on the clamping sections 312 and extend axially over the entire sleeve section 308 into the head section 310. The clamping mandrel 322 has four second round wedge sections, such as 338. The second round wedge sections 338 are arranged on the clamping mandrel outer surface and extend axially over the entire mandrel section 326. When the clamping sleeve 300 is pushed onto the clamping mandrel 322, the first round wedge sections 336 and the second round wedge sections 338 correspond to one another, so that the clamping device can be adjusted between the release position and the clamping device by rotating the clamping sleeve 300 about the sleeve axis 302 or the clamping axis.
[0040] Fig. 8 shows the corresponding round wedge sections 336, 338 of the clamping device in the release position in a developed view. Fig. 9 shows the corresponding round wedge sections 336, 338 of the clamping device in the clamping position in a developed view.
[0041] The first round wedge sections 336 arranged on the clamping sleeve 300 and the second round wedge sections 338 arranged on the clamping mandrel 322 are geometrically complementary to one another and each have a wedge surface that constantly rises or falls in the circumferential direction. At the round wedge sections 336, 338, the clamping sleeve 300 and the clamping mandrel 322 each have a minimum radius r2, a maximum radius r1, and a taper length l. k This makes the clamping device self-locking in the clamping position and easy to release.
[0042] To clamp a workpiece, the clamping sleeve 300 is pushed onto the clamping mandrel 322 until the second stop section 320 of the clamping sleeve 300 and the stop section 332 of the clamping mandrel 322 abut one another, and the workpiece is pushed onto the first stop section 320 of the clamping sleeve 300. The clamping sleeve 300 is then rotated in the clamping direction 340, whereby the interaction of the round wedge sections 336, 338 causes the clamping sleeve 300 to expand and clamp the workpiece. To release the workpiece, the clamping sleeve 300 is rotated in the release direction, whereby a clamping force is eliminated and the clamping sleeve 300 automatically assumes its original shape.
[0043] According to a specific embodiment, the clamping sleeve 300 has an outer radius r on the sleeve portion 308 in the release position. a of 1.37mm, with the minimum radius r2 1 mm, the maximum radius r1 1.08mm and the cone length l k1.185 mm, corresponding to an angle of 68.5°. In the clamping position, this specific clamping sleeve 300 has an outer radius r on the sleeve section 308 a of 1.39mm, whereby to adjust between the release position and the clamping position it is necessary to turn the clamping sleeve 300 by 5°.
